Frank Ocean Confirmed to Perform at The Grammys
Musician Up For Six Awards
Let’s all agree not to tell Chris Brown—Frank Ocean has been confirmed as a performer at this year’s Grammy Awards on February 10. He will join other announced acts Justin Timberlake, Jack White, The Black Keys, Alicia Keys, Maroon 5, Rihanna, Mumford & Sons, Taylor Swift and more.
Of course, we kinda already guessed that. Last week, after Ocean and Brown got into a dustup over a parking space (thus fulfilling Brown’s mandate to fight everything in the greater Los Angeles area), Ocean tweeted the following: “Cut my finger now I can't play w two hands at the grammys.”
In addition to performing, Ocean is up to take home a few trophies, as a nominee in six categories—including the record and album of the year for his debut, Channel Orange.
